On 04/10/13 08:44, Kristoffer Egefelt wrote:
> Hi,
>
> I'm trying to pass through a NIC (intel X520 with ixgbevf driver) to
> domU, but since kernel 3.8 this has not worked.
>
> The dom0 kernel seems to cause the problem.
> Xen version, domU kernel version and driver version seems to be
> unrelated to this bug, meaning
> it works as long as dom0 kernel is 3.8.
> I tried kernel version 3.9, 3.10 and 3.11 - all show the same bug
> pattern when used as dom0.
>
> The BUG appears on xl pci attach.
> On pci detach the dom0 panics.
>
> I have attached logs from a working setup (kernel 3.8) and from a
> setup not working (kernel 3.11) and also the kernel config for 3.11.
>
> In short, this is what domU logs after pci attach:

This Xen crash appears to be as a result of d1b6d0a0248 "x86: enable
multi-vector MSI", and is likely a mishanding of some error state caused
by the initial pci attach failure/partial setup.
Can you printk() in xen/arch/x86/msi.c:pci_restore_msi_state() just
before the list_for_each_entry_safe() and work out which is the
problematic pci device, then run `xl debug-keys iQM` and provide the
output. Perhaps an lspci of the affected device might also help.
